![](https://img-blog.csdnimg.cn/20201014180756925.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
Cmake---之配置文件的使用
锥子A
这个作者很懒,什么都没留下…
展开
-
Cmake----使用说明简介
说明本文转载自 博主 网络资源是无限的 该处链接https://blog.csdn.net/fengbingchun/article/details/46685413 。CMake是一个跨平台的编译自动配置工具,它使用一个名为CMakeLists.txt的文件来描述构建过程,可以产生标准的构建文件。它可以用简单的语句来描述所有平台的安装(编译过程)。它能够输出各种各样的makefile或者p...原创 2019-07-08 09:05:08 · 542 阅读 · 0 评论 -
Cmake---之编译模式设置
转载自http://aigo.iteye.com/blog/2295102一般Debug和Release必须在不同的目录下编译,否则每次当切换模式时必须把编译文件全部删掉。这里假设新建两个目录Debug和Release来分别用于构建相应的模式:终端输入mkdirRelease cdRelease cmake-DCMAKE_BUILD_TYPE=Release...转载 2019-07-08 09:18:50 · 4822 阅读 · 0 评论 -
CMAKE---构建动态库
cmake是一种跨平台的构建工具。它可以生成各种平台支持的makefile和project文件。在windows下,一般都是用visual studio来管理工程。事实上,就本人来说,使用cmake主要是为了避免在linux下手写makefile的繁琐。cmake在ubuntu下的安装:sudo apt-get install cmake下面来看如何使用cmake构建动态库。...转载 2019-07-08 09:40:19 · 9183 阅读 · 0 评论 -
Cmake----基本概念1
你或许听过好几种 Make 工具,例如 GNU Make ,QT 的 qmake ,微软的 MS nmake,BSD Make(pmake),Makepp,等等。这些 Make 工具遵循着不同的规范和标准,所执行的 Makefile 格式也千差万别。这样就带来了一个严峻的问题:如果软件想跨平台,必须要保证能够在不同平台编译。而如果使用上面的 Make 工具,就得为每一种标准写一次 Makefile...转载 2019-07-08 09:51:47 · 211 阅读 · 0 评论 -
Cmake----动态库和静态库的编译
opencv2.4.8,下载:Here.ubuntu下CMake编译生成动态库(.so)和静态库(.a),以OpenTLD为例。直接看CMakeLists.txt吧。cmake_minimum_required( VERSION 2.8 ) set(PROJECT_NAME OpenTLD) project(${PROJECT_NAME}) ...转载 2019-07-08 09:57:15 · 2590 阅读 · 0 评论 -
Cmake----构建动态库和静态库
cmake是一种跨平台的构建工具。它可以生成各种平台支持的makefile和project文件。在windows下,一般都是用visual studio来管理工程。事实上,就本人来说,使用cmake主要是为了避免在linux下手写makefile的繁琐。cmake在ubuntu下的安装:sudo apt-get install cmake下面来看如何使用cmake构建动态库。...转载 2019-07-08 10:01:32 · 1045 阅读 · 0 评论 -
Cmake----CMakeList.txt模板
在多级目录下,工程目录的CMakeList.txt的模板 cmake_minimum_required( VERSION 2.8 )project( guoguo )# 设置用debug还是release模式。debug允许断点,而release更快#set( CMAKE_BUILD_TYPE Debug )set( CMAKE_BUILD_TYPE Release )# 设...转载 2019-07-08 10:14:52 · 792 阅读 · 0 评论 -
clion cmakelists.txt配置实现跳转及编写入门
参考配置:# cmake_minimum_required(VERSION 3.11)project(redis_4_0_9 C)set(CMAKE_C_STANDARD 99)#add_executable(redis_4_0_9 ./src/siphash.c)set( SOURCE_FILES ./src/adlist.c ....原创 2019-08-15 12:43:52 · 3384 阅读 · 0 评论